3D printing is a versatile technology that can be used for both fun and practical problem-solving.
The Prusa Mark IV is compared to a reliable Toyota Corolla, while the Bamboo Labs X1 is likened to a fast Tesla Model S.
Both the Prusa and Bamboo Labs printers are recommended for hobbyists and beginners due to their ease of use and reliability.
The open-source nature of Prusa printers contributes to their reliability and ease of servicing.
Bamboo Labs has democratized features from expensive industrial 3D printers, making them accessible to consumers.
Input shaping is a software process that allows Bamboo Lab printers to be significantly faster than traditional printers.
Prusa Mark IV has the potential for input shaping, which will be enabled in a future software update.
Both recommended printers feature automated bed leveling and a variety of sensors to ensure successful prints.
Prusa Slicer and Bamboo Lab's version of the software are both user-friendly and essential for 3D printing.
Wireless connectivity and color screens on both printers enhance the user experience.
The hot end and extruder of the printers can handle a wide range of materials, offering versatility in what can be printed.
The Bamboo Lab P1P is recommended for beginners due to its balance of features and affordability.
For those who value reliability and a track record, the Prusa Mark III S Plus kit is a good alternative.
Building a printer kit can provide valuable insight into the machine's workings and help with future maintenance.
3D printing can be used to solve specific problems and is not limited to just printing pre-existing models.
Hiring a 3D modeler through platforms like Fiverr or Upwork can be a cost-effective way to get custom parts made.
Learning 3D modeling software like Fusion 360 is a worthwhile investment for those interested in the full capabilities of 3D printing.
The potential applications of 3D printing are vast, and the technology is becoming increasingly accessible and popular.

necessarily Hardware the reason why
bamboo lab 3D printers are so
ridiculously fast and they are fast
isn't because they figured out how to
make stepper Motors move faster they're
using a process called input shaping and
this is essentially factoring the
resonance or natural frequency of the
printer and compensating for it in the
movement of the machine if the printhead
accelerates in One Direction the
software anticipates how the printer
structure is going to react and
effectively cancels it out this is why
prints can be up to four times faster on
this machine than the prusa although on
average I found it to be about twice as
fast which is still really considerable
I should be fair and note that the prusa
mark IV which is the one I showed is
their brand new model which is capable
of input shaping as well at least from a
hardware standpoint at the time of its
release that feature isn't available but
it should be in the next software update
so that Corolla is getting tuned up it
should print much faster but probably
still won't be able to touch the speed
of the bamboo lab machine so what the
heck does all that mean why do you care
well as a new 3D printing Enthusiast
absolute speed may not be the most
important consideration getting the damn
thing to work without you thinking about
it should be top of the list both of
these machines have a bevy of sensors
and automation to help accomplish this
for starters both printers run through a
bed leveling process before each print
which is very important for getting that
first layer plastic to stick to the
print bed this is one of the most common
failure modes on a 3D printer and having
this handled by the machine and not your
chubby fingers is great the next is
software every 3D printer uses a program
called a slicer it takes a solid shape
slices it into very thin layers and
creates a file containing G-Code that
the printers need to run and you really
don't need to know anything about that
other than there are some settings that
you can tweak to make your part print
potentially better prus has developed
one of the absolute best out there
called prusa slicer and bamboo lab has
essentially taken that exact same open
source program and put their spin on it
so the good news is that both of these
printer options use very solid software
that's easy to use both machines have
these big clear color screens that are
easy to navigate they both also have the
ability to wirelessly connect to your
computer so that you can start a print
from anywhere this beats the hell out of
transferring files on a USB stick or an
SD card
ask me how I know and finally both
printers have a hot end and extruder
this part that squeezes the molten
plastic out that can handle a wide
variety of materials so you won't really
be constrained on what you can print
with
Okay so we've got two solid options here
which one do I ultimately recommend you
go buy if you're getting started
neither instead
I recommend
you go buy this one this is the bamboo
lab p1p which is the stripped down less
flashy version of the X1 I showed
previously it's about 500 cheaper and is
still an absolute Beast of a machine you
lose some side panels the fancy touch
screen and a couple of sensors but the
printer itself is fantastic it checks
all the boxes of what you need to get
started my default answer to anyone
asking what printer I would recommend
has always been prusa but now since I've
got to test the offerings from bamboo
lab
this p1p is the clear recommendation
going forward but if you're more of a
Toyota guy which I totally get and like
the idea of reliability and a track
record instead of buying the new prusa
mark IV which I showed earlier pick up
the now discounted Mark III S Plus kit
it's about the same price as the p1p and
you just have to sacrifice the big
screen Wireless connectivity and some
speed it may have heard me say kit and
the benefit of going with a kit versus a
pre-built machine is that you get to
build the printer and become intimately
familiar with how it works I built my
first couple prusas and I really enjoyed
this process and even made a video a
while back showing what goes into it you
can go check that out if you're
interested you'll have a good
understanding of your machine and how to
fix it should something need be replaced
down the road and that's one of the
biggest knocks on the new bamboo lab
machines fixing or replacing parts does
not appear to be anywhere near as user
friendly
or even possible in some cases but
honestly you won't go wrong with either
one but all things being equal I give
the nudge to the p1p all right so you
